Super Robot Taisen Compact 2 was the second Super Robot Taisen strategy RPG to be released on the WonderSwan. Like Super Robot Taisen F/ F Final before it, Compact 2 is split into multiple parts: Part 1 and Part 2 occur simultaneously, while Part 3 continues from Part 2. Using the WonderSwan's internal memory, players can send their clear data to each successive game; several events are altered based on the player's previous save, gained items are carried over to Part 3, and a special final scenario can be unlocked by clearing the entire trilogy within 777 turns. The game, like its predecessor, borrows almost all of its gameplay mechanics from F/F Final; however, it introduces the "Support System" which immediately became a core mechanic of the SRW franchise. Part 3 is the final chapter, as Londo Bell and the Cyber Beast Force unite to finish off the Einsts once and for all.
